Throughout 2023, we’ve witnessed numerous significant cyber incidents. One of the largest this year was the MOVEit breach, which impacted various state motor vehicle organizations and exposed driver’s license information for nearly 9.5 million individuals. ‘Ray Hushpuppi’, an Instagram celebrity, was sentenced to 11 years in jail for conspiring to launder tens of millions of dollars via business email compromise (BEC) scams and other cyber frauds. Authorities in Australia, the United Kingdom and the United States this week levied financial sanctions against a Russian man accused of stealing data on nearly 10 million customers of the Australian health insurance giant Medibank.
